Kaushik - First of all if you are talking about inbound call routing that's carrier controlled.

If you are talking about outbound based on CLID then why do you want to use trunk groups and not utilize just the dial-peers to send the outbound calls to required E1 lines. Trunk groups are generally used to bundle together E1 lines.

I suppose you are using CUCM for call control. You can create incoming VOIP dial-peers based on ANI and then setup translation rules to prefix a digit. Your outbound dial-peers will route based on those digits.

For example: 1111 > Incoming dial-peer 1 selected, prefixes 9 > Outbound dial peer(destination-pattern 9.!) 10 matched, call sent to port 1.

2222 > Incoming dial-peer 2 selected, prefixes 8 > Outbound dial peer(destination-pattern 9.!) 20 matched, call sent to port 2.
